Off-road Full Electric Pallet Jack VS Indoor Electric Pallet Truck Feature Break
Many factory operators work on rough terrain covered with gravel, pits and uneven ground, requiring pallet trucks that adapt to harsh outdoor conditions. If you cannot confirm whether an off-road model is necessary, this guide fully explains the Differences Between Off-road Walk-behind Electric Pallet Truck & Standard Pallet Truck, sorted into 5 core distinctions of the Off-road Full Electric Pallet Jack.
1. Tires & Ground Clearance: Huge Gap In Passing Capacity
Standard indoor electric pallet jacks use small smooth PU solid wheels without anti-slip treads, with only 50–70mm ground clearance. They are limited to epoxy floors and flat cement warehouse surfaces. Gravel and pits easily jam wheels and scratch hydraulic chassis; minor muddy roads cause slipping and sinking, completely unfit for unpaved outdoor yards. The Off-road Full Electric Pallet Jack is fitted with wide deep-tread rubber off-road tires for strong anti-slip grip. Ground clearance is raised to 100–180mm with full bottom anti-collision guards. It rolls smoothly over shallow pits, gravel and small curbs without chassis scraping on muddy or stone stockyards.

2. Motor Power & Climbing Performance: Heavy Load Capacity Gap
Ordinary indoor pallet trucks adopt low-torque 24V drive motors, only capable of climbing gentle slopes below 3° under full load. They lack sufficient power for factory loading ramps or outdoor inclines and risk sliding backward, only suitable for short flat indoor transfers. Off-road versions are equipped with sealed high-torque 48V brushless motors matched with heavy-duty gearboxes, boosting power output by over 30%. They steadily climb 5°–15° slopes with full loads, handling construction ramps, long factory gradients and truck loading/unloading without stuttering during heavy-load startup.
3. Chassis Frame Structure: Shock Resistance & Service Life
Standard electric pallet trucks feature thin bent welded frames with no underbody protection. Long-term vibration and bumping easily crack welds and bend forks, only designed for light-duty low-wear indoor operation. The off-road pallet truck uses double-thick high-strength integrated welded steel frames, paired with full wrap-around bottom guards and built-in simple shock absorption. The robust structure withstands constant vibration on gravel yards without deformation, ideal for long-term transport of 2–3 ton heavy construction materials.

4. Electric Control IP Rating: Dividing Line For Harsh Outdoor Environments
Standard indoor pallet trucks have unsealed controllers and wiring. Rainwater and construction dust easily penetrate components and short out the drive unit, restricted to dry enclosed warehouses and prohibited for outdoor rainy or dusty work. All electrical parts on the off-road model are fully sealed for dustproof and waterproof protection, drastically lifting IP rating. It runs reliably under light rain, heavy dust and humid outdoor yards, cutting failure rates by 70% and supporting both indoor and outdoor multi-scenario use.
